Our Story
In 1975, 41 local veterinarians founded Orange County Emergency Pet Clinic to provide quality after-hours emergency care for their patients. Our after-hours hospitals offer a vital service for veterinarians and pet owners in Fullerton, Garden Grove, and surrounding communities. Our emergency clinics are the go-to place for after-hours pet emergencies, including car accidents, trauma, fractures, poisonings, and other emergencies.

Overall Experience
The reviews of the Emergency Pets Hospital are mixed, with some customers having a positive experience and others having a negative one.
Positive Experience
Customers who had a positive experience praised the hospital's staff, specifically mentioning the kindness, professionalism, and attentiveness of the receptionists, doctors, and nurses. Many reviewers were grateful for the hospital's prompt attention, gentle care, and effective treatment of their pets. Some customers appreciated the hospital's ability to calm their nerves and guide them through a difficult situation.
Negative Experience
On the other hand, customers who had a negative experience complained about the hospital's long wait times, high prices, and lack of care for their pets. Some reviewers felt that the hospital was more concerned with making money than with providing quality care. A few customers reported poor communication, disregard for their concerns, and even cruelty towards their pets.
Specific Issues
Some specific issues mentioned by customers include:
- Long wait times (up to 6 hours)
- High prices for treatment and cremation services
- Poor communication and lack of empathy from staff
- Disregard for customer concerns and feelings
- Mistakes made during treatment, such as misplacing ashes or not performing promised services
